Navigation
Back up to About Overview
[+] Expand All
[-] Collapse All
Symbols
A
C
- C Series Controllers
- C Series controllers
- C Series platforms
- candidate configuration
- CLI
- command hierarchy
- command history
- command mode
- configuration mode
- command completion
- commands 1, 2
- comparing
- entering 1, 2
- exiting
- hierarchy 1, 2, 3
- navigation commands
- overview 1, 2
- statement description
- symbols in statement lists 1, 2
- verifying configurations
- editing level 1, 2
- environment settings
- help 1, 2
- interface elements
- keyboard sequences
- messages
- modes
- operating systems
- overview 1, 2
- password
- prerequisites
- privilege levels
- prompt strings
- tutorial
- working directory
- command output
- commands
- commit and-quit command 1, 2
- commit check command
- commit command 1, 2
- configuration
- configuration files
- configuration hierarchy
- configuration mode See CLI
- configuration statements
- deleting
- overview 1, 2
- symbols in statements
- configure command
- conventions
- count filter
- cursor, moving
- customer support 1
D
- delete command 1, 2
- directories on C Series Controller
- documentation
E
- edit command 1, 2
- enable command
- environment settings, CLI 1
- except filter
- exit command 1, 2
F
H
I
K
L
M
- manuals
- messages
- MORE filter
- MORE prompt
N
O
- online help See CLI, help
- operational mode
P
Q
R
- redrawing screen
- regular expressions
- rename command 1, 2
- request system halt command
- request system reboot
- restart command 1, 2
- rollback command 1, 2
- run command
S
- save command
- screen
- set cli complete-on-space command
- set cli directory command 1, 2
- set cli language command
- set cli level command
- set cli password command
- set cli prompt command
- set cli screen-length command
- set cli screen-width command
- set cli terminal command
- set command 1, 2
- show cli authorization command
- show cli command
- show cli history command
- show cli level command
- show command
- show component command 1, 2
- show configuration command
- show system information command
- SRC CLI
- starting
- SRC components
- SRC modules
- SRC software
- statements See configuration statements, names of individual statements
- support, technical See technical support
- symbols in statements
T
U
- up command
- URLs in commands
- user accounts
W
X
Download This Guide
Key Features of the SRC CLI
The hierarchical organization results in commands that have a regular syntax and provides several features that simplify SRC CLI use:
- Consistent command names—Commands that provide the same type of function have the same name, regardless of the portion of the software on which they are operating. As examples, all show commands display software information and statistics, and all clear commands erase various types of system information.
- Lists and short descriptions of available commands—Information about available commands is provided at each level of the CLI command hierarchy. If you type a question mark (?) at any level, you see a list of the available commands along with a short description of each command. This means that if you already are familiar with the SRC software, Junos OS, or routing software, you can use many of the CLI commands without referring to the documentation.
- Detailed descriptions of command and configuration statements—Complete information about commands and statements from the help command. You can access the reference documentation for each command and statement by typing the help command followed by the command or help configuration followed by the configuration statement.
- Command completion—Command completion for command names (keywords) and for command options is also available at each level of the hierarchy. To complete a command or option that you have partially typed, press the Spacebar or the tab key. If the partially typed letters begin a string that uniquely identifies a command, the complete command name appears. Otherwise, a caret (^) indicates that you have entered an ambiguous command, and the possible completions are displayed. Completion also applies to other strings, such as filenames, interface names, usernames, and configuration statements.
Leveraging Industry-Standard Technologies
The operating system on a C Series Controller is based on a Linux kernel, with a special shell called the CLI (command-line interface). A variety of standard utilities are available. For example, you can:
- Use regular expression matching to locate and replace values and identifiers in a configuration, or to filter command output.
- Use Emacs-based key sequences to scroll through command output or edit the command line.
- On a C Series Controller, store and archive system files
on a Linux-based file system.
- You can use standard Linux conventions to specify filenames and paths.
- You can exit from the CLI environment and create a Linux shell to navigate the file system, manage system processes, and so on.
Related Documentation
- SRC CLI Overview
- Using SRC CLI Command Completion
- Using Keyboard Sequences at the MORE Prompt in the SRC CLI
- Getting Help for Commands and Statements for the SRC CLI